St Vincents Presents Exclusive Residency by Parisian Brand Pierre Augustin Rose

This fall, St. Vincents, an Antwerp-based art and design gallery, brings you an exclusive showcase by the Parisian brand Pierre Augustin Rose. This residency is a special celebration of their enduring partnership. Pierre Augustin Rose will take center stage on the gallery’s ground gloor, offering a glimpse of their carefully curated furniture and lighting collection.

The Visionary Minds Behind the Brand

At the heart of Pierre Augustin Rose are the innovative minds of Pierre Bénard, Augustin Deleuze, and Nina Rose. Their deep love for unique spaces and their profound knowledge of 20th-century art and design influences their creative direction. Together, they reimagine classic design styles through a modern lens.

“In perfect harmony towards the same ambition of style, we do not seek to participate in a competition of originality but to impose with integrity, a personal style, an ode to the perennial modernity without giving up certain audacity.” — Pierre Bénard

Exploring the World of Semi Kim

In collaboration with Korean artist Semi Kim, this residency marks a significant milestone for the gallery. With more than 20 distinctive pieces created by the design trio, this program provides a thorough dive into the studio’s vision, principles, and sources of inspiration. It also offers visitors the opportunity to engage with the collection and gain insight into the meticulous craftsmanship that went into creating these works.

Craftsmanship at Its Finest

The commitment to French modernism and craftsmanship shines through in Pierre Augustin Rose‘s collection. You’ll find exquisite lacquers, high-quality fabrics, and impeccable detailing. Notably, their “Fumoir” leather lounge chair stands as a pinnacle of French savoir-faire, taking up to 45 days to complete.

An Unconventional Presentation

This exhibition breaks away from traditional showroom norms. It features a distinctive backdrop that complements the luxurious Parisian collection, as described by Geraldine Jackman, co-founder of St. Vincents.

Explore a captivating blend of iconic and contemporary items, including the curvaceous Sofa 280, the bold Minitore armchair, and the Polus 002 chair with a sled-shaped oak base. The Forum Table, Daphne chairs, and Eole pendant light offer a diverse and captivating display.

Immediate Purchase Opportunity

While the usual waiting time for custom orders is 16 to 18 weeks, the items on display at the exhibition will be available for immediate purchase and delivered after the show, bypassing the standard lead times.

This exclusive showcase runs until 25 November, 2023. It is a unique opportunity to immerse yourself in the world of Pierre Augustin Rose.
